Pros

Edelman's extensive client list provides employees with the opportunity to work with some of the biggest brands in digital/consumer/health/travel.

Cons

Edelman is by far the worst corporate culture I have ever experienced in my 10+ years on the job market. Account teams are ridiculously unorganized and upper management is populated with opportunistic and disingenuous individuals that play favorites and are all too eager to throw junior staff under the bus at a moment's notice. Rude emails, name calling, unjustified accusations of inefficiency, screaming obscenities on company conference calls: all part of the day-to-day life at Edelman. And if you think the Human Resources department will be there to help you when you inevitably bear the brunt of this abuse, think again! Edelman's HR department is by far the worst I have ever encountered. There are plenty of PR companies out there. Learn from my mistake and think twice before signing on the dotted line with these folks.

Pros

I worked with some of the brightest and best people in the business. Most of them are no longer with the company. Some good clients, and nice office space.

Cons

Very limited opportunities for growth. During my time they reduced promotions to only once a year, and made many excuses for promoting as few people as possible (despite becoming the first "$1B" agency at that time). Morale was extremely low. People were forced to come into an office with nobody they actually worked with. Common to be passed from manager to manager. At one point I had 6+ managers within a 10-month span.
